I was spoilt for choice with this board. In the end, I went with the diagonal row, top left to bottom right - Sequins, Shaker Card and Die Cut.

I had cut this shaker card idea about a year or so ago, and it was just languishing on my desk! To create this card, I cut x2 panels of the pretty floral paper and affixed one of them to my card blank. I die-cut a circle from the other panel and added some acetate and foam tape to make it into a shaker panel. The sequin mix in my shaker is very cute, it has teeny tiny little butterflies in it too.

The sentiment is from one of my all-time fave stamp sets by Neat and Tangled 'Awesome' I have had it since 2016.

I stamped the sentiment in navy ink as I thought it would fit better with the colours of the paper.

I was inspired to create cards that use journal cards as the focal point.

Journal cards are so pretty, sadly I am not a journaler, but I figured out a way to incorporate them into cards.

Main photo - I used a 4x4 journal card, die-cut using a square stitched die from my stash. I anchored the card using a strip of paper from the kit and popped it up using foam tape, the sentiment is by Ellen Hutson. I made x2 of these. I think you could easily hand-cut these out and skip the stamp or handwrite a sentiment.


Photo above - I used x2 different journal cards here and I let them help me choose the backgrounds. The bird card has 'hello' on it and that inspired my stamp choice. The 'go your own way' card made me think of arrows, so I used a Dyan Reaverly stencil to create the background. Also very easy. You could also use papers from the kit for the backgrounds if you prefer.


Photo above - I went with a small square card, mini square cards are very cute! Again used 4x4 journal cards. I used dies to cut the cards and the larger paper squares. The papers are from the kit. You could always cut the squares by hand. 

I used -
MPM April 2024 - Genuine Kit

From my stash - stamps, dies, stencils, Distress Oxide inks, black ink, foam tape, die-cutting machine, paper trimmer, double-sided tape.

I went with your choice (bling) - die cut or punch - stencil.

I love stencils and I am a big fan of these 'create in quads' ones by Taylored Expressions, you layer the stencils over letter-sized paper and end up with x4 different stenciled panels. Clever.

The one I used here is from the TE Quad monthly club and is called 'Pattern Party'.  I decided it was the perfect background for one of my fave Monsters by 'Your Next Stamp' the set is 'Way Cool Monsters' and I have had it since 2019. I am sad to say goodbye to YNS as they are closing their doors after 14 years, they are the reason for my love of Monster stamps. I added some googly eyes to my Monster.

My die-cuts are obviously my Monster and the yellow panel.

I stacked the sentiments, because I wanted to use the Favorite Human stamp by Technique Tuesday, I find that this sentiment always works well with Monsters! It is from their 'Favorite Human' set and I have had it since 2017.

Because the background is so busy, I didn't want the 'your choice' element to get lost, so I went with large blingy gems, so they would stand out and not get lost.
